Log Message:
`use base` claims to be able to find the named parent module even
when it's defined otherwise than a separate file with a matching
name. When committing to the NetBSD wiki, I'm seeing RPC::XML errors
that suggest otherwise ("Can't locate RPC/XML/datatype.pm" and so on).

I don't know why we're having this problem on wiki.n.o and I haven't
managed to reproduce it elsewhere, but it sure looks fixed after
switching to `use parent -norequire`. `use parent` seems to be
generally preferred usage anyway.

Bump PKGREVISION.
